After a short offensive burst just before halftime to lead by 14, A&T picked up its zone trap pressure early in the second half and dominated with its new found trio of big men; Ed Jones, James Porter, and Thomas Coleman en route to a easy 82-51 win over Montreat.
Again it was forward Jason Wills leading the way with a another very solid overall 18 point performance in the paint to top A&T in scoring. This third straight win moves A&T to 3-2 for year, the first above .500 mark this early in the season since 1986 and its second straight win of 30 points or better.
